在当今数字化高速发展的时代,网络安全已成为企业和个人用户不可忽视的核心议题,虚拟私人网络(Virtual Private Network,简称VPN)作为保障数据传输安全的重要技术手段,广泛应用于远程办公、跨境业务、隐私保护等多个场景,本文将深入探讨VPN通信的基本原理、工作流程以及其背后的关键安全机制,帮助读者全面理解这一关键技术。
什么是VPN?VPN是一种通过公共网络(如互联网)建立加密隧道的技术,使用户能够像在局域网中一样安全地访问私有网络资源,它本质上是“虚拟”的——不依赖物理线路连接,而是利用加密协议在公共网络上构建一条逻辑上的专用通道。
典型的VPN通信流程包括以下几个关键步骤:
-
客户端发起连接请求:当用户启动VPN客户端软件时,会向指定的VPN服务器发送认证请求,该请求通常包含用户名、密码或数字证书等身份信息。
-
身份验证:服务器端验证用户身份,常见认证方式包括PAP(Password Authentication Protocol)、CHAP(Challenge Handshake Authentication Protocol)和EAP(Extensible Authentication Protocol),现代企业级VPN常采用基于证书的身份验证,安全性更高。
-
协商加密参数:一旦身份验证通过,客户端与服务器之间会进行密钥交换和加密算法协商,常用协议包括IKEv2(Internet Key Exchange version 2)、OpenVPN、IPsec(Internet Protocol Security)等,这些协议不仅提供加密功能,还确保数据完整性与防重放攻击。
-
建立加密隧道:双方建立一个加密隧道(Tunnel),所有经过该隧道的数据包都会被封装并加密,在IPsec模式下,原始IP数据包会被包裹在新的IP头部中,并使用ESP(Encapsulating Security Payload)协议进行加密处理。
-
数据传输:用户在加密隧道中发送的数据(如网页浏览、文件传输、邮件通信)不会被第三方窃听或篡改,即使数据包被截获,攻击者也无法解密内容。
-
断开连接:当用户结束会话时,客户端主动发送断开请求,服务器终止隧道,释放资源。
值得注意的是,不同类型的VPN服务在实现细节上存在差异。
- 站点到站点(Site-to-Site)VPN:用于连接两个固定地点的网络,常用于企业分支机构互联;
- 远程访问(Remote Access)VPN:允许移动用户通过互联网接入公司内网;
- SSL/TLS-based VPN(如OpenVPN):基于HTTPS协议,易于部署且兼容性强;
- IPsec-based VPN:更适用于高安全性要求的场景,如政府和金融行业。
从安全角度看,优秀的VPN系统应具备以下特性:
- 强加密算法:如AES-256(高级加密标准);
- 前向保密(PFS):即使长期密钥泄露,也不会影响历史通信的安全;
- 防止DNS泄漏:确保所有DNS查询也走加密隧道;
- 日志策略透明:避免服务商滥用用户数据。
用户也需警惕“伪VPN”或“免费VPN”带来的风险,这些服务可能记录用户行为甚至植入恶意软件,选择正规厂商提供的商业级解决方案至关重要。
VPN通信不仅是技术工具,更是数字时代隐私与安全的基石,随着零信任架构(Zero Trust)等新理念的兴起,未来VPN将更加智能化、轻量化,并与其他安全机制深度融合,为全球用户提供更可靠的网络环境。

半仙VPN加速器

